Tunisia: salivary tests to detect drugs soon in public space
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

After the breathalyzers, make way for anti -drogated tests. Colonel Sami Saoudi has announced the next deployment of fast saliva tests in Tunisia. These devices will make it possible to detect the consumption of narcotics, including outside the road frame.

The result in a few minutes

During an intervention on Mosaic FM, Colonel Sami Saoudi, spokesperson for the National Observatory for Road Safety, revealed that Tunisia is preparing to introduce new drug tests. These are salivary tests capable of quickly detecting the presence of stunning substances in the body. The result is obtained in just a few minutes.

These devices will complete the ethylots already used to control the alcohol level in drivers. According to the colonel, their use will not be limited to road controls: they will also be applied in public space in the broad sense.

Tunisia faces an upsurge in drug consumption offenses, including young people. The authorities seek to strengthen the means of control to prevent risky behavior, especially behind the wheel. These saliva tests are part of a wider road safety policy and the fight against addictions.

New generation bloodswoman

In the same context, Colonel Sami Saoudi, announced on July 17, the upcoming deployment of electronic blood alcohol detection devices across the country. These are intelligent devices for immediate controls, new generation blood tests, offering a quick and precise measurement of the alcohol level in the expired air and providing an instant result.
